This one I don't think anybody can do anything about, but
it's worth asking: In my stage setup I slave the AN1x to an
external sequencer by setting the VOICE COMMON Tempo setting
to MIDI. And for the Delay, I always choose TempoDly. If this
setup worked smoothly, it would be so great. But what happens
is: a) I get a crackling noise and b) sometimes, not always,
the AN1x crashes!! freezes! I have to turn it on and off to
bring it back to life. When I change the Tempo setting to
an internal clock setting (like 120), the crackling goes away
and it doesn't crash. Has anybody else encountered this? Found
any solutions? Maybe this is part of the reason they discontinued
them.
Also, on one of my AN1x's, as soon as I touch the ribbon controller,
it keeps defaulting to the lowest (left setting), instead of having
the middle be the default. So, often when I touch it, the filter
cutoff goes to zero, unless I hold my finger on it in the middle
somewhere. On my other AN1x, this never happens. It always keeps the
middle as the default. Is this a version problem, or is there a
setting I can change?
